Can Sinopec 95 and PetroChina 95 be mixed?

92 gasoline and 95 gasoline cannot be mixed because their isooctane content is different. 92 gasoline is suitable for low-compression engines, while 95 gasoline is suitable for high-compression engines. If 92 gasoline is added to a car that should use 95 gasoline, abnormal combustion will occur, leading to knocking. Knocking not only damages the combustion chamber but also directly affects the normal operation of the engine, and in severe cases, may cause engine damage. If 95 gasoline is added to a car that should use 92 gasoline, although it will not damage the engine, 95 gasoline is more expensive than 92 gasoline, resulting in waste. Differences between 92, 95, and 98 gasoline: Standard gasoline is composed of isooctane and n-heptane. Isooctane has good anti-knock properties, and its octane number is defined as 100; n-heptane has poor anti-knock properties and is prone to knocking in gasoline engines, so its octane number is defined as 0. If the gasoline is labeled as 92, it means that the gasoline has the same anti-knock properties as standard gasoline containing 92% isooctane and 8% n-heptane. The same principle applies to 95 and 98 gasoline. How to handle adding the wrong gasoline: If the gasoline added has a higher octane number than the car's specified gasoline, for example, adding 95 gasoline when 92 is specified, you can simply switch back to 92 gasoline after the current fuel is consumed. If the gasoline added has a lower octane number than the car's specified gasoline, for example, adding 92 gasoline when 95 is specified, you only need to add a high anti-knock fuel additive. Of course, you can also directly drain the fuel and refill with 95 gasoline. To find out which gasoline your car should use, you can refer to the car's user manual or check the fuel grade marked on the fuel tank cap.

What engine is used in the R8 convertible?

The engine of the R8 convertible is produced at Audi's Neckarsulm factory. The engine model used in the R8 convertible is a 5.2-liter naturally aspirated V10, with a maximum horsepower of 620 hp, a maximum power output of 397 KW, a maximum power speed of 7800 rpm, and a peak torque of 570 N.m. For daily maintenance of the R8 convertible's engine, the following methods can be used: Use lubricating oil of appropriate quality grade. For gasoline engines, SD--SF grade gasoline engine oil should be selected based on the additional equipment of the intake and exhaust systems and usage conditions; for diesel engines, CB--CD grade diesel engine oil should be selected according to mechanical load, with the selection standard not lower than the manufacturer's specified requirements; Regularly change the oil and filter. The quality of any grade of lubricating oil will change during use. After a certain mileage, performance deteriorates, leading to various engine problems. To avoid malfunctions, oil should be changed regularly based on usage conditions, and the oil level should be kept moderate; When oil passes through the fine pores of the filter, solid particles and viscous substances in the oil accumulate in the filter. If the filter is clogged and oil cannot pass through the filter element, the filter element may burst or the safety valve may open, allowing oil to bypass through the bypass valve, bringing contaminants back to the lubrication area, accelerating engine wear and increasing internal pollution; Regularly clean the crankcase. During engine operation, high-pressure unburned gases, acids, moisture, sulfur, and nitrogen oxides from the combustion chamber enter the crankcase through the gap between the piston rings and cylinder walls, mixing with metal powder from component wear to form sludge. A small amount remains suspended in the oil, while a large amount precipitates, clogging filters and oil passages, making engine lubrication difficult and causing wear; Regularly use a radiator cleaner to clean the radiator. Removing rust and scale not only ensures the engine operates normally but also extends the overall lifespan of the radiator and engine.

What is the replacement interval for a timing belt?

The replacement interval for a timing belt is approximately 60,000 kilometers, but it varies depending on the vehicle model. The exact replacement interval can be found in the vehicle's maintenance manual, and it should adhere to the manufacturer's requirements. The functions of a timing belt are: 1. To drive the engine's valve train; 2. To ensure the engine's intake and exhaust valves open and close at the appropriate times; 3. To guarantee the engine cylinders can properly intake and exhaust air. The steps to replace a timing belt are: 1. Lift the vehicle and remove the right front wheel fender liner; 2. Remove the alternator belt and alternator belt tensioner; 3. Loosen the crankshaft pulley bolt; 4. Open the engine hood and remove the coolant reservoir; 5. Remove the engine mounting bracket and the protective cover on the timing belt; 6. Unscrew the alternator mounting bolt and remove the alternator; 7. Remove the cylinder block mounting bracket and take off the crankshaft pulley; 8. Rotate the crankshaft to the top dead center position of the cylinder and mark it; 9. Remove the timing belt and timing tensioner for replacement.

What car has a triangle next to an S?

A triangle next to an S represents DS Automobiles, a premium luxury automotive brand under the PSA Group. The full French name of DS is 'Deesse,' which means 'goddess' in French. DS is a top-tier luxury automotive brand in French industrial design and is highly popular in French politics, often referred to as the presidential car. From Charles de Gaulle to François Hollande, DS has served as the official vehicle for French presidents. The PSA Group is a French private automotive manufacturing company owned by Peugeot S.A., encompassing five major automotive brands: Peugeot, Citroën, DS, Opel, and Vauxhall.

What is the BMW Auto Start-Stop Function?

Engine auto start-stop technology automatically shuts off the engine when the vehicle comes to a temporary stop (such as waiting at a red light) during driving. When it's time to move forward again, the system automatically restarts the engine. 1. Advantages of the auto start-stop function: The benefit is that when driving on stop-and-go roads, shutting off the engine under conditions where auto start-stop is active can save fuel and reduce exhaust emissions. 2. Disadvantages of the auto start-stop function: The auto start-stop function places stringent demands on the battery. Vehicles equipped with this feature require larger batteries and higher-quality starter motors.

What is the BSD button on Borgward?

BSD: Blind Spot Detection system, which uses millimeter-wave radar to detect the blind spots on both sides of the vehicle while driving. If another vehicle enters the blind spot area, it will alert the driver with a light indicator on the rearview mirror or a designated position, along with a buzzer alarm, informing the driver of the best time to change lanes and significantly reducing the risk of traffic accidents caused by lane changes. Additional information: The Blind Spot Vehicle Identification System not only helps drivers stay relaxed and comfortable but also plays a crucial role in driving safety. 1. Reduces safety hazards during lane changes; 2. Minimizes uncertainty in judgment; 3. Enhances driving safety.

What Causes the Popping Sound from the Exhaust Pipe When Starting a Car?

Abnormal sounds from the exhaust pipe are mainly caused by an excessively rich or lean air-fuel mixture. The reasons for and solutions to abnormal sounds from a car's exhaust pipe are as follows: 1. Damaged exhaust pipe: The engine exhaust emits high-temperature and high-pressure exhaust gases, along with some backfire explosions. In this case, the exhaust pipe needs to be replaced immediately. 2. Engine misfire: In a multi-cylinder engine (most car engines are four-cylinder), the exhaust processes of each cylinder are interconnected. If one cylinder stops working, the exhaust sequence will be disrupted, causing abnormal sounds from the exhaust pipe. In this situation, professional repair personnel must be consulted for repairs.
